Ataqi-Ouli (also spelled Atakti-ouli or Ataki Ouli) was a proto-chevspendic Cheifton who according to popular mythology united the tribes into the Chevspendic Horde.
Life
What we know about Ataqi-Ouli primarily comes from written versions of oral history made by Sahren scholars. Thus the earliest record about him is the Otbasi Chronicle written in 2109, however this source was primarily concerned with the individual families and only made a passing mention of Ataqi-Ouli for background context. According to this source he was a warrior of great prowess who rose to power of Otbasi Siyah-Kon (Black horse) tribe, and went on to reform the Chevspendi into a tribal oligarchy.
The Chevspendic Primary Oral Chronicle goes into more detail about him, and instead describes him as an individual of immense wit and strategy. It states in 1809 he became cheiftan of the Siyah-Kon, and then spent the rest of his rule began negotiating agreements of mutual benefit with the other tribes while launching increasingly bold raids settled civilizations.
